There is no direct connection from Radicofani to Assisi. However, you can take the bus to Chiusi Stazione-P.Zza Dante, walk to Chiusi-Chianciano T., take the train to Terontola-Cortona, take the train to Perugia, walk to Fontivegge - Perugia, then take the bus to P.za Matteotti Assisi.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Radicofani - Luchini 1 to P.za Matteotti Assisi via Chiusi Stazione-P.Zza Dante, Chiusi-Chianciano T., Perugia P.S.Giov, and Ponte San Giovanni in around 5h.
